When Is Labor Day 2023?

This year, Labor Day falls on Monday, September 4. That means that the new movies opening for Labor Day weekend this year are primarily coming to theatres on September 1.

Labor Day 2023 — New Movies to Watch in Theatres

Three big movies are opening for Labor Day this year.

The Equalizer 3The Equalizer 3 | Cinemark

Denzel Washignton returns as Robert McCall. He's in Italy trying to put his old life behind him, but a run-in with the Sicilian Mafia pulls McCall back into a world of violence.

 

 

 

BottomsBottoms | Cinemark

PJ and Josie have the hots for their school's cheerleaders, so they hatch an obvious plan: Start a fight club so they have a reason to hang out with the cheerleaders. You know, like we all did, right? But when their plan actually works, the girls realize they've created the structure for their own downfall.

 

 

The Good MotherThe Good Mother | Cinemark

The Good Mother follows journalist Marissa Bennings (Swank) who, after the murder of her estranged son, forms an unlikely alliance with his pregnant girlfriend Paige (Cooke) to track down those responsible for his death. Together they confront a world of corruption and drugs in the underbelly of a small city in upstate New York.
